I have an Amada NC IronWorker that I am having problems with the NC locator. If I jog the NC locator in manual, and press the jog button, let the locator move 1/2 to 1 inch, then release the button. The locator moves. If I try to go any farther, it jumps non stop forward, reverse, forward, reverse about 1-3 inches each way until I press the estop.

I am thinking it is either the servo amp, or the encoder. I don't have a way to test either. I have slowed the travel speed down using the parameters in the controller, and that helped some, but it is getting worse. It is almost unusable now.
About a year, year and a half ago, I had to replace several capacitors on the controller board.
There are several adjusting pots on the amp. They are NF---I-ADJ---GAIN---OS--- and DZ.
the encoder is a SUMTAK LDA-146-500.
